Connie (Davis) Herbert

Connie Herbert, 65, of Ammon, Idaho, passed away August 15, 2021, at Eastern Idaho Regional Medical Center. Connie was born September 30, 1955, in Bountiful, Utah, to Neale G. Davis and Barbara Lavaun Davis.  She grew up and attended schools in Centerville, Utah, and graduated with honors from Viewmont High School.  Connie went on to attended Ricks College and Utah State University. On October 3, 1975, she married Robert "Leo" Herbert in Centerville, Utah. Their marriage was later solemnized in the Salt Lake City Temple on January 14, 1977. Connie and Leo made their home in Ammon, where Connie owned and operated Drug Collections of Eastern Idaho.

She was a member of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ints and served as the Ammon Stake Relief Society President and  in  several Relief Society, Primary, and Young Women presidencies over the past 39 years. Connie and Leo served a mission for the church in Florida Ft. Lauderdale Mission.  She loved serving her family and friends.  She enjoyed spending time with her children and grandchildren.  She enjoyed shopping, and loved her horses, goats, many dogs, rabbits and other animals.  She always thought of others and their needs and was one of the first to show up with a kind word, thoughtful gift or comfort food.   Her testimony of the Gospel of Jesus Christ was a light to many.

Connie is survived by her loving husband, Leo Herbert of Ammon, ID; mother, Barbara Davis of Centerville, UT; their six children, Christy (Tory) Taylor of Ammon, ID, Michael (Christine) Herbert of Lehi, UT, Morgan (Megan) Herbert of Watertown, SD, Jason Herbert of Iona, ID, Justin (Brenna) Herbert of Ammon, ID, and Jared (Bethany) Herbert of Ammon, ID; three brothers, Brian (Darlene) Davis of Lindon, UT, Gary (Jan) Davis of Warren, UT, and Wayne (Sheila) Davis of Francis, UT; and 16 gr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her father, Neale G. Davis; and brother, Scott Davis.
